Are you a landlord or letting agent? If so please read on

If you’re a landlord or managing agent in the Wrexham area you can keep up to date with any changes or updates that may affect your or your tenants by attending the next meeting of the Landlord’s Forum which will take place at the Catrin Finch Centre, Glyndwr University at 5.30 on Tuesday February 5.

This is a particularly important meeting as there will be updates on the many changes that are already in place and those that are coming up in the next 12 months, these will include:

The Water Industry (Undertakers Wholly or Mainly in Wales) (Information about Non-owner Occupiers) Regulations 2014

Private Water Supplies

Fire Risk Assessment Campaign

Update on Energy Performance and Grant Support

Wrexham Council- Homeless Prevention Strategy

Other relevant agencies will be present during the event and will provide information and answer any questions.

We would ask that anyone wishing to attend please email healthandhousing@wrexham.gov.uk with the Subject: Landlords forum Feb 19 Invitation Request and just provide your name.

There will be a buffet provided about 6.45pm.
